Ordered take-out for a quick dinner (pork ramen with extra egg and a side of kimchi); the attendant was very friendly and the restaurant appeared clean and comfortable.

The quality of the ramen is exceptional; for the price, it’s easily some of the best ramen you can get. The broth is rich and creamy and the eggs are perfectly seasoned. Wu’s does a very good job balancing out its meat, broth, noodles, and other additions (like the mushrooms or the bean sprouts) to where each bite has a very good mixture of different components; this was the most notable thing about the ramen, as I have never tried one as well “balanced” as this (see photo).

Overall? 10/10. Very happy with it and would go again without hesitation.

Always a 5 star experience at Wu’s Ramen and Poke. This particular location is amazing and you can tell the love and care they put into the food. Homemade noodles that melt in your mouth with just the right amount of chewy tenderness. Veggies are always clean and fresh and crisp. They do a really great job with the char on the Pork Chashu and the kimchi is a great addition. My favorites are the Spicy Miso Ramen and the Spicy Tonkotsu. If you’re really hungry the Potstickers are a great addition and I like to
split them in half and add them to the Ramen. I usially always leave with a nice portion for leftovers as well and if ya wanna treat yourself you can get a good bottle of sake for like 15 extra bucks. Meal is usually around 30 bucks unless you add the sake and that will run you up towards 45-50. Usually get a Taro Boba for dessert they do a great mix:) One day I’ll be able to wait more than 5 mins before I start devouring to get a fresh pic of the food right when it comes out lol
